How they compare
Brazil currently reports 0.4% against 0.4% in Norway,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 26 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Brazil ahead.
Brazil ranks 167th and Norway ranks 167th of 206 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Brazil averaged higher in 2 and Norway in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Brazil | Norway |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 2.0% | 0.3% | 1.7% | Brazil |
| 2010s | 0.8% | 0.3% | 0.5% | Brazil |
| 2020s | 0.4% | 0.4% | 0.0% | Norway |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
